* [PATCH 1/6] audio/jack: fix invalid minimum buffer size check
  2020-06-13  4:05 [PATCH 0/6] audio/jack: fixes to overall jack behaviour Geoffrey McRae
@ 2020-06-13  4:05 ` Geoffrey McRae
  0 siblings, 0 replies; 3+ messages in thread
From: Geoffrey McRae @ 2020-06-13  4:05 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: qemu-devel; +Cc: kraxel, geoff

JACK does not provide us with the configured buffer size until after
activiation which was overriding this minimum value. JACK itself doesn't
have this minimum limitation, but the QEMU virtual hardware and as such
it must be enforced, failure to do so results in audio discontinuities.

Signed-off-by: Geoffrey McRae <geoff@hostfission.com>
---
 audio/jackaudio.c | 22 +++++++++++-----------
 1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)

diff --git a/audio/jackaudio.c b/audio/jackaudio.c
index 722ddb1dfe..d0b6f748f2 100644
--- a/audio/jackaudio.c
+++ b/audio/jackaudio.c
@@ -434,17 +434,6 @@ static int qjack_client_init(QJackClient *c)
     jack_set_xrun_callback(c->client, qjack_xrun, c);
     jack_on_shutdown(c->client, qjack_shutdown, c);
 
-    /*
-     * ensure the buffersize is no smaller then 512 samples, some (all?) qemu
-     * virtual devices do not work correctly otherwise
-     */
-    if (c->buffersize < 512) {
-        c->buffersize = 512;
-    }
-
-    /* create a 2 period buffer */
-    qjack_buffer_create(&c->fifo, c->nchannels, c->buffersize * 2);
-
     /* allocate and register the ports */
     c->port = g_malloc(sizeof(jack_port_t *) * c->nchannels);
     for (int i = 0; i < c->nchannels; ++i) {
@@ -468,6 +457,17 @@ static int qjack_client_init(QJackClient *c)
     jack_activate(c->client);
     c->buffersize = jack_get_buffer_size(c->client);
 
+    /*
+     * ensure the buffersize is no smaller then 512 samples, some (all?) qemu
+     * virtual devices do not work correctly otherwise
+     */
+    if (c->buffersize < 512) {
+        c->buffersize = 512;
+    }
+
+    /* create a 2 period buffer */
+    qjack_buffer_create(&c->fifo, c->nchannels, c->buffersize * 2);
+
     qjack_client_connect_ports(c);
     c->state = QJACK_STATE_RUNNING;
     return 0;
